The phrase "after reply" is not correct and does not convey a clear meaning in written English.
It may be intended to refer to something that occurs following a response, but it lacks clarity and context.
Example: "Please send me the document after reply." (This is unclear and awkward.)
Alternatives: "after responding" or "following your reply".
